Well, if you think about it, 5.5 for Pitchfork is actually okay. And Metacritic says it's averaged at about 62, which is decent. I don't think it's being slammed so much as people are disappointed because it was ridiculously hyped.

 

My only complaints are:

 

1. The album is too produced. Those random yells and stuff in the background are so annoying, and her voice is divided into too many layers on most songs. Every song seems like it's LONGER than it actually is because there's too much stuff jammed into every tune.

 

2. The depth of the album isn't very versed. Her attitude on every song is pretty much the same, bored-sounding, melancholy girl. I dunno, maybe I'm just being overly-critical.

 

3. Album is messy, doesn't flow well. Reminds me of Coldplay's X&Y: It's too ambitious and there's filler junk on it.

 

 

But I think overall it's pretty good, and the p4k review is fair. Though I'd probably be more generous, but p4k is NOT generous whatsoever. Well, the MX review was a weird anomaly.
